The following probability distribution graph has a missing value for the outcomes of x = 2 and x = 6. Note that x = {1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6}.
Furthermore, P(x = 2) + 3P(x = 6) = 0.7
Determine the probability outcomes of both P(x = 2) and P(x = 6). Show all your work.

x123456p(x)0.1a0.20.30.1b\begin{matrix} x & 1 & 2 & 3 & 4 & 5 & 6 \\ p(x) & 0.1 & a & 0.2 & 0.3 & 0.1 & b \end{matrix}

0.1+a+0.2+0.3+0.1+b=10.1+a+0.2+0.3+0.1+b=1a+3b=0.7a+3b=0.7

a+b=0.3a+b=0.3a+3b=0.7a+3b=0.7

a+b=0.3a+b=0.32b=0.42b=0.4

a=0.1a=0.1b=0.2b=0.2

x123456p(x)0.10.10.20.30.10.2\begin{matrix} x & 1 & 2 & 3 & 4 & 5 & 6 \\ p(x) & 0.1 & 0.1 & 0.2 & 0.3 & 0.1 & 0.2 \end{matrix}

P(X=2)=0.1P(X=2)=0.1

P(X=6)=0.2P(X=6)=0.2
